Transfer of peeling cream for filling

Task:
Facial and body peeling creams are to be transferred from drums and mixing containers to the filling process.

Solution:
F560 GS eccentric worm-drive pump
Three-phase electric motor
Accessories, hoses and fittings

Application description:
Prior purchasing the FLUX eccentric worm-drive pump, the creams were transferred by hand into filling machine feed hoppers. This proved to be not only slow and inefficient, but also hygienically problematic. Now FLUX has improved transfer speeds and hygienic conditions.

The material is pumped from drums and mixing containers placed alongside the filling systems. Low rotational speeds ensure very gentle pumping action. Shearing of the product is very low – as is the case for FLUX worm-drive pumps in general – and therefore there is no danger that the consistency of the products will change. Product level in the feed hoppers is monitored using level sensors and the F560 pumps are switched on and off automatically as needed.  Consequently the filling process is faster and more efficient – delivering significant ROI for the customer.

Transferring shampoo raw materials

Task:
Shampoo raw materials are to be dispensed from 200-litre plastic drums into a mixing tub – previously this had been done manually. A simple and, most importantly, time-saving solution was required.

Solution:
F560 GS eccentric worm-drive pump
F458 fully sealed commutator motor
Accessories and hoses

Application description:
A mid-size company producing high-quality natural cosmetics had been transferring raw materials by manually scooping them from drums. Not only time-intensive but also resulted in a high degree of spillage and waste. The F 560 GS FOOD eccentric worm-drive pump is now used for these transferring the materials.

Being light-weight, portable and easy to clean, this pump is an ideal solution. Removing products up to 25,000 mPas from the 200-litre drums is problem free. The materials are quickly dispensed into a mixing vessel, where the final product is produced. Finished product is then metered into consumer bottles on a filling line and packaged for sale.

Filling high-viscosity liquid soap

Task:
Filling of high-viscosity liquid soap, and the raw materials for its production, e.g. glycerin, from IBCs into various production containers. Most of these products are high-foaming when splash filled.

Solution:
F 560 GS eccentric-worm drive pump
F 458 fully sealed commutator motor
FMO flow meter
FLUXTRONIC® batch controller
FSV100 Switched-mode amplifier
Hoses and accessories

Application description:

The Flux F560 GS eccentric worm-drive pump is ideal for rapidly and safely transferring soaps. It is available in two hygienic designs, with either 3A or FDA / EC1935 FOOD certification.

The compact F 560 GS model is portable, easy and safe to use. A double-walled IP55 sealed motor guarantees that carbon deposits from the motor cannot accidentally contaminate the customers products. If the container (e.g. IBC) is only accessible via the bottom outlet, a trolley mounted version (TR version) could be used as an alternative.

These pumps provide gentle, pulsation-free pumping with extremely low shear forces. This reduces the chance of extreme foaming. The F550 can even handle thicker soap deposits that may have formed at the base of the vessel.

Our FMO flow meter with FLUXTRONIC® batch controller can be fitted to our eccentric worm-drive pumps. This enables the pump to be upgraded to a semi-automated filling system, recommended for repeat, high-accuracy filling of smaller containers, or for batch transfer to mixing vessels.

Dispensing Vaseline from 200-litre drums into batching tanks

Task:
High-viscosity Vaseline requires dispensing from a 200-litre drum into a batching tank via a heated pipeline.

Solution:
VISCOFLUX mobile S drum emptying system
F560 S eccentric worm-drive pump
Spur gear motor
Hoses and accessories

Application description:
Transferring Vaseline from a 200-litre drum to a filling hopper. Since the transfer distance, with 10-meter DN 40 pipeline and 4-meter hose, is relatively long, the discharge piping will be heated. This reduces product viscosity, keeping the pipeline back pressure within calculated limits. The VISCOFLUX mobile S drum emptying system for high-viscosity, non-free-flowing media, combined with our F 560 S eccentric worm-drive pump is the perfect hygienic solution.

The VISCOFLUX mobile S is rolled up to the drum and the follower plate lowered onto the surface of the product. The pump is turned on. At the end of the discharge line, an employee measures the Vaseline into the batching tank which stands on scales. Once the desired weight is reached, the employee closes a ball valve. The rising pressure is monitored with a pressure switch and the  pump is switched off automatically. The pump starts again when the ball valve is reopened and pressure drops. The cut-out/cut-in pressure can be predefined precisely in accordance with the process parameters.

Pump speed can be varied easily using the spur gear motor, meaning pump speed can be increased or decreased to handle changes in viscosity between summer and winter temperatures.

Dispensing essential oils, perfume oils, fragrance agents and essences

Task:
Basic cosmetic ingredients, such as oils, fragrances and other essences, require dispensing from 200 l drums. The pump must be certified (hygienic approval, e.g. FOOD or FDA certification) and must be suitable for use in Zoned areas where flammable vapours may be present.

Solution:
F430 S FDA Ex drum pump with mechanical seal
F460 Ex commutator motor
Hoses and accessories

Application description:
The F430 is made from high quality stainless steel. Welds are filed to remove bug traps and surfaces are polished to 10 micron finish. The F430 can be used for a variety of liquids up to 1000 mPas. Frequent liquid changes are no problem, as the pump can be disassembled into its two main parts for cleaning extremely quickly.  All areas in contact with the liquids are easily accessible. A mechanical seal ensures liquid cannot enter the inner tube, minimizing any risk of cross-contamination.

F430 is highly portable, ensuring different liquids can be transferred from different sized containers easily and safely.

Decanting perfume oils into mixing systems

Task:
Perfume oils require decanting from 200 l drums into a mixing system.

Customer requirements:
- Easy to clean
- Portable

Solution:
FP430 S drum pump with mechanical seal
F460 Ex commutator motor
Hose and accessories

Application description:
FLUX F430 S with FOOD and Ex certification is the ideal solution for quick, safe decanting of perfume oils. The pump is highly portable and extremely easy to maintain.

The pump can be dismantled into its two main parts without any tools, making cleaning supremely easy. Cross-contamination risk is minimised due to the sealed inner tube assembly. The F460 motor is IP55 rated with a double-walled housing. This ensures carbon deposits from the motor cannot drop into the product.

The operator carries the drum pump to the point of use, inserts it in the container and connects the discharge hose. Moving the pump between different containers is easy, especially when a non-return valve is installed on the pump outlet. Dispensing is controlled manually via a hand nozzle and quantity is monitored via scales.

Filling of ethanol

Task:
Transferring Ethanol from IBCs and 200 l drums into smaller containers with minimal waste and high accuracy.

Customers requirements:
- Explosion protected (Ex) pumps
- No residue left in containers
- Fast and repeatable

Solution:
F425 Drum pump for 99.98% emptying
F460 Ex Commutator motor
FMC100 flow meter
Hose and accessories

Application description:
The FLUX F425 pump with explosion protection certification for flammable liquids is the perfect solution for drum emptying leaving minimal residue.

When emptying 200 l drums, the unique design of the F425 ensures residues of less than 0.05 l remain. In addition, the manually controlled non-return valve on pump inlet prevents the liquid from flowing back into the emptied drum. This enables optimum use of the product - perfect for high value liquids.  FLUX can guarantee a reduction in drum cleaning and waste disposal costs too.

Removing the liquid is simple: The pump is inserted into the container to be emptied and the motor switched on.

By using our FMC flow meter with FLUXTRONIC® batch controller, the desired fill quantity can then be safely and accurately metered into small containers.

When combined with an FSV100 switching amplifier, the desired fill quantity can be entered and dispensing can be  completed automatically at the touch of a button. Once the desired quantity is reached, the pump stops automatically and the filling process can begin again.

Transferring high viscosity healing clay

Task:
Abrasive healing clay requires decanting from 200 l drums into hopper, from which the healing clay is then transferred into the packaging directly via two integrated metering pumps. The customer required a fast, efficient, mobile solution to eliminate manual handling.

Solution:
ViscoFlux Mobile S Drum emptying system
F560S Eccentric worm-drive pump
Spur gear motor
Hoses and accessories

Application description:
Our VISCOFLUX mobile S portable drum-emptying system is ideal for transferring demanding, high-viscosity and abrasive healing clay. The system was specially developed for use in the pharmaceutical, food and cosmetic industries. It carries FDA / EN1935 certification for use in sanitary applications.

Consisting of a process device with IP 66 rating, spur gear motor, eccentric worm-drive pump, follower plate and  process seal, it offers highly efficient drum emptying leaving residues of less than 1%.

The VISCOFLUX mobile S is easy to clean and easy to use, thanks to its simple operation. Various control options are available, from manual on-off through to one-touch automatic dispensing using our Fluxtronic batch controller.  In addition, filling speed can be varied using the spur gear motor's speed controller.
